Tokyo, Japan
Dive into the electrifying pulse of Japan's capital — wander the neon-lit alleys of Shinjuku, explore the ancient Senso-ji Temple in Asakusa, and lose yourself in the layered history of the Imperial Palace gardens as autumn begins to paint the city gold.
-
Nikko, Japan
Step into a world of breathtaking opulence as the ornate Tosho-gu Shrine emerges from cedar forests ablaze with early autumn color — a sacred mountain town that feels like walking through a living painting of Edo-era grandeur.
-
Hakone, Japan
Breathe in the crisp mountain air and let Mount Fuji's majestic silhouette reflect across the still waters of Lake Ashi — a serene cultural escape where traditional ryokan hospitality and open-air art museums create an unforgettable highland retreat.
-
Kyoto, Japan
Immerse yourself in the soul of ancient Japan — stroll the thousands of vermilion torii gates at Fushimi Inari, meditate in the moss-covered Zen gardens of Ryoan-ji, and wander the lantern-lit lanes of Gion where geisha culture still breathes quietly through time.
-
Nara, Japan
Walk freely among sacred deer in Japan's first permanent capital — visit the awe-inspiring Todai-ji Temple housing a colossal bronze Buddha, and feel the deep spiritual energy that has drawn pilgrims to this extraordinary cultural heartland for over a thousand years.
-
Osaka, Japan
Unleash your senses in Japan's kitchen — savor street food wonders like takoyaki and okonomiyaki in the dazzling Dotonbori district, discover the imposing Osaka Castle surrounded by autumn foliage, and feel the infectious energy of a city that lives to eat, laugh, and celebrate.
-
Hiroshima, Japan
Bear witness to one of humanity's most profound stories of resilience — walk through the haunting Peace Memorial Park, stand before the skeletal A-Bomb Dome, and leave with a renewed sense of hope inspired by a city that transformed tragedy into an enduring message of peace.
-
Miyajima, Japan
Watch in wonder as the iconic floating torii gate of Itsukushima Shrine appears to rise from the sea at high tide — this sacred island, wrapped in forested hills and ancient Shinto spirituality, is one of Japan's most transcendent cultural and visual masterpieces.
-
Fukuoka, Japan
End your Japanese odyssey in a vibrant gateway city buzzing with yatai street food stalls, the ancient Dazaifu Tenmangu shrine, and a youthful energy that perfectly blends tradition and modernity — a fitting farewell filled with flavor, culture, and warm Kyushu spirit.
